Assistant Practitioners, Band 4.

Bargoed ward on Ysbyty Ystrad Fawr is looking for a caring, compassionate, enthusiastic, dedicated and competent Assistant practitioners.

If you are a highly experienced health care support worker with a level 4 qualification, looking for an opportunity to secure promotion and work within a dynamic and forward thinking team, with a passion for patient care, then an Assistant Practitioner role could be for you

Aneurin Bevan University Health Board is currently undertaking a once in a career transformation of how health care will be delivered in South East Wales and we have an exciting opportunity for you to be a unique part of our new and dynamic staffing model at the forefront of patient care as an Assistant Practitioner - (Nursing).

This is a innovative role which will be a key part of the ward team providing essential support to Registered Nurses and delivering direct patient care through enhanced skills. You will also supervise HCSW’s at Band 2&3.

You will be a pivotal member of a multidisciplinary team, providing high quality care to patients in our ward settings. You will support the nurses by providing clinical nursing support and enhancing the quality of hands on care. You will work without direct supervision, with delegated responsibilities from the Registered Nurse which could include wound care, blood glucose monitoring, ECG recording, vital observations and NEWS, cannulation.

The health board provides integrated acute, primary and community care serving a population of 650,000 and employing over 16,000 staff.
